  • The Experience of Higher Education
    Peter Marris
    Originally published in 1964 The Experience of Higher Education reports the findings of about 400 intensive interviews with final year undergraduates at three universities - Cambridge, Leeds and Southampton - and a College of Advanced Technology in London.   • Family and Social Change in an African City
    Peter Marris
    This book is a study of the pattern of social life which developed in the slums of central Lagos; and of the effects of a compulsory slum clearance scheme on the lives of those who were removed. ...

  • Widows and their families
    Peter Marris
    One of the first books to be published in the UK on bereavement, this ground-breaking study presents the results of a survey of widows in London. ...
